No. 8 Marietta (2-7) at No. 1 Heidelberg (9-0): Heidelberg 3, Marietta 0
-Heidelberg is led by 16th-year head coach Jason Miller and claimed the OAC Regular-Season title with a perfect 9-0 record. The Berg is making the program's 24th appearance in the tournament and will look to junior Sarah Parker who is averaging 3.84 kills and 1.18 digs per set. Sophomore Rachel Raimondo is averaging 5.22 digs/set and junior Karlie Diruzza is averaging 10.85 assists/set. |SEASON STATS|
-Marietta is under the direction of first-year head coach Bob Howard and will be making the programs 19th trip to the tournament. The Pioneers will look to seniors Shauntiel Oliver-Smith with 141 kills and a team best .147 attack percent and Devin Walter with a team leading 231 kills and a .135 attach percent. |SEASON STATS|
-Heidelberg defeated Marietta 3-0 in the regular-season. |BOX SCORE|

ADMISSION
For quarterfinals on Tuesday, admission shall be $7 for adults, $5 for Seniors (62) and $2 for non-OAC students.
For the semifinals on Thursday, admission shall be $7 for adults, $5 for Seniors and $2 for non-OAC students.
On Saturday the admission is $7.00 for adults, $5 for Seniors and $2 for non-OAC students.
OAC students are admitted free of charge with valid ID. OAC 2015-16 passes are not valid for the tournament. OAC Lifetime passes will be honored.
HOST RESPONSIBILITIES
Each host for the tournament is responsible for the preparation and cost of a program. The host school is also responsible for statistics of all games at its site. In addition, the host shall directly pay from gate receipts the clock/scoreboard operator, ticket seller, scorekeeper, and announcer. Please see OAC Financial Report Form for guidelines.
TOURNAMENT RECEIPTS
After the hosts collect gate receipts and pay allowable expenses, they should forward any remaining funds along with the financial report as soon as possible to the OAC office.
